C-2 · Spring Hill, KSSECTION 17.326 - C-2 GENERAL BUSINESS DISTRICT A. Purpose. It is the purpose of this district to provide a zone, which will accommodate the broad range of retail shopping activities and service and offices. The C -2 district is generally appropriate for areas designated as “Mixed-Use Commercial” by the Spring Hill Comprehensive Plan. The C -2 district should typically be directed to limited areas appropriate for highest intensity development such at interchanges along U.S. 169 Highway, rather than near residential neighborhoods. It is intended for application in those areas in the city limits of Spring Hill where adequate public facilities and infrastructure are available. (Ord. 2006-48) B. Permitted Uses. In District C-2 no building, structure, land or premises shall be used and no building or structure shall be hereafter erected, constructed, reconstructed, moved or altered, except for one or more of the following and their customary accessory uses: 1. Agriculture uses Agriculture, subject to Section 17.336.A.1 2. Residential uses NONE, except residential dwellings may be permitted subject to approval of a P-O Protective Overlay District in accordance with Section 17.334. Approval of a P-O district shall establish specific development standards for residential uses in the underlying C-2 district. (Ord. 2006-48) 3. Public and civic uses Church or place of worship, subject to Section 17.336.A.6 Community assembly Cultural group, subject to Section 17.336.A.6 Golf Course Government service Library Parks and recreation Recycling collection station, public, subject to Section 17.336.A.14 School, elementary, middle and high, subject to Section 17.336.A.6 Utility, minor 4. Commercial uses Animal care, limited, subject to Section 17.336.A.2 Automated teller machine Banks and financial institutions Construction sales and service, retail uses only, subject to Section 17.336.A.8 Convenience store Funeral home Medical service Spring Hill Unified Zoning Ordinance and Spring Hill Subdivision Regulations 66 Ord 2025-19 Spring Hill, Kansas Office, general Personal care service Personal improvement service Post office substation Printing and copying, limited and general Retail, limited and general Restaurant Secondhand store Vocational school Wholesale or business services 5. Industrial manufacturing and extractive uses NONE C. Conditional uses. The following uses shall be permitted in the C-2 district if reviewed and approved by the Planning Commission and Governing Body in accordance with the procedures and standards of Section 17.354. 1.
